## Cron Drift Investigation — Quickstart

New folks: the Marrowfield batch jobs drift roughly 40 seconds per day against wall clock. Root cause is still open; leading theory is the NTP config on the older Kestrel nodes. Read the incident doc before touching anything.

To reproduce, run the drift probe from the tooling repo and compare against the reference clock. Probe builds must be signed or the fleet agents reject them.

Signed builds verify against the key below — add it to your keyring first.

signing key of yaguf-fahog = bky4_vuxJ

## Tuning Sproutwell's Scheduler

Sproutwell computes watering windows from soil-moisture readings and a per-zone budget. For review purposes, note that all sensor input is clamped and rate-limited before it can influence valve timing, so a spoofed reading cannot extend a watering run beyond the hard ceiling. Each constant below is validated at startup and logged on change. The enforced defaults are as follows.

tuning table, fawip-fahag:
WEIGHTS = {
    "novwyn": 452,
    "casdor": 675,
}

## Recovery: Tollgate Billing Worker (Blue-Green)

If a blue-green cutover strands the Tollgate billing worker's deploy account, do not roll forward. Flip traffic back to the last healthy color, then re-authenticate the deploy account via the recovery CLI. Reviewers: confirm the rollback commit before unlock. The CLI prompts once; supply the recovery passphrase given below.

vault phrase of tajeg-tageg = pelix-druix-holius-briael-zorwyn-frawyn-fraox-norok-drueth-aldiel

**Break-glass: Legacy ORM refactor safeguards**

Reviewers: the ongoing refactor of the Cobblestitch ORM layer replaces hand-rolled query builders with the new Lanternmap adapter. Both paths run in parallel behind a flag, with row-level diffs logged nightly. If the adapter corrupts a write and the flag service is unreachable, break-glass access lets you flip the kill switch directly on the database proxy. Approve no merges that remove the dual-write path until migration completes. The break-glass console accepts the passphrase shown below.

unlock words, fadug-yagug: fraael-pramir-ulaax-zorys-gorvan-brieth